Comment (by fhahn):
I think this issue is already fixed in master.
#18969 describes a similar issue and the test case provided there tests
year lookups with a year < 1000. This test case worked for me with
postgres and sqlite. The SQL is generated correctly. String lookups for
{{{__year}}} work as well.
We should probably close either this ticket or #18969 as duplicate.
